> > "FCC Chairman Tom Wheeler has spoken several times about how he plans to
> > preempt state laws that limit municipal broadband networks. In 20 states,
> > there are legal restrictions making it tough for cities and towns to
> offer
> > Internet service to residents."
> >
> > "So what will the FCC do? "I believe that it is in the best interests of
> > consumers and competition that the FCC exercises its power to preempt
> > state laws that ban or restrict competition from community broadband.
> > Given the opportunity, we will do so," Wheeler wrote."
